WWE Released two more

from WWE.com

WWE.com received the following information from the office of Jim Ross, WWE’s Executive Vice President for Talent Relations:

Terri Runnels and WWE have mutually agreed to terms to part ways. Terri has been a great member of our team for almost seven years, and we wish her the best and would enjoy working with her again if the situation presents itself.

Sean O’Haire has been notified that he will be released from his contract. Sean is an excellent athlete and we wish him well in his future endeavors.

I found out what happend to Terri and O'Haire.

Rajah explains Sean O'Hair's situation like this: Many people backstage were not surprised that Sean O’Haire was released last week. O’Haire received a phone call last week telling him that the creative team was unable to come up with ideas for him and that he would be released from his contract. One of the reasons for the release was that some people did not feel that he was dedicated enough to make it in the WWE and that he didn’t do enough to get himself noticed by management. Other people believe that O’Haire was a victim of Roddy Piper leaving the company, which before then he was expected to receive a major push.

As for Terri, apparently, she left on her own accord. She had a job for the company as long a she wanted. I guess she was feeling unloved by the writers like Spanky.
